Cerro de Pulido
Cerro de Pulido is a hill in El Córbano (El Córvano), Monte Bonito (D. M.)., Azua Province and has an elevation of 550 metres. Cerro de Pulido is situated nearby to the locality Agua Clara, as well as near El Caimán.Places in the Area

Padre Las Casas
Town
Padre Las Casas is a municipality of the Azua province in the Dominican Republic. It includes the municipal districts of La Siembra, Las Lagunas, and Los Fríos.
